Yamaha Repower - Recommended Dealers

We have decided to just repower our boat rather than try to fix our 2005 Yamaha F150 four stoke. The boat is rated for up to a 250. So we are looking for recommend Yamaha dealers to do the repower. Not sure which size engine we will go with, as we are starting to research which size Yamaha has had the best track record lately.

What kind of boat? Length? Honestly sometimes going up 50-100 HP can actually give you better MPG, and of course your top speed increases.

Have you considered a Suzuki or Etec? I think the Etecs are now coming with a 10 year warranty and are pretty damn nice.

I don't know if I can recommend Sunray - although they did a pretty good job installing my motor, over the years they have screwed up a few things and I just don't think they take the time and effort to do things just right.

Boat is a 22ft Sea Hunt Triton.

We might be considering Suzuki. I have nothing against Etecs, but there isn't really room to add an oil reservoir.

Apparently Yamahas are in short supply. We were told that a 150 may be able to be received within a few weeks, but a 200 we were looking at might take 6-9 months!

Yamaha is the most appealing since the boat is already rigged for a Yamaha.
